    FCA Heritage - Affiliation

    All,

    Today, I've had confirmation that the SEC is now recognised by/affiliated to FCA Heritage. This is "FCA" as in "Fiat Chrysler Automobiles", and gives us quite the boost up the credibility ladder.
    This has come about because they approached us, as part of a drive to link to clubs who support their significant makes and models. I pointed out that the vast majority of our cars aren't the genuine article but replicas/homages, but they were cool with that, which supports my assertions recently in my Rants that our cars are becoming appreciated in their own right. Think it also helped that we're the Stratos ENTHUSIASTS' Club, rather than Owners Club, which obviously allows for replica and genuine cars.
    This doesn't mean we can start passing our cars off as the Real Thing (unless they are!), but now there really is no need to be apologetic that "it's only a kit car".

    Anyway, great news for the club!
